Trademark Classes in Nigeria Explained: 2026 Guide

In the world of brand protection, you cannot own a name for "everything." Intellectual property is divided into specific categories. If you register your trademark in the wrong category, your protection is useless. Trademark classes in Nigeria follow the international Nice Classification system, which divides all goods and services into 45 classes.

Knowing your class is the difference between a legal shield and a "Soft" waste of money. Here is the 2026 guide to the 45 classes.


🏗️ 1. The Structure: Goods vs Services

The 45 classes are divided into two groups:

  • Classes 1 to 34 (Goods): Physical products like chemicals, paints, food, and machinery.
  • Classes 35 to 45 (Services): Activities like advertising, finance, education, and hospitality.

For the Nigerian entrepreneur, these are the heavyweights:

  • Class 3: Cosmetics, perfumes, and cleaning products.
  • Class 5: Pharmaceuticals and nutritional supplements.
  • Class 9: Technology, software, and digital downloads.
  • Class 25: Clothing, footwear, and fashion.
  • Class 30: Coffee, tea, and processed foods.
  • Class 35: Advertising, retail services, and business management.
  • Class 41: Education, entertainment, and YouTube creators.

📋 3. The "Multi-Class" Strategy

In 2026, many brands exist in more than one category.

  • The Example: If you have a fashion brand called "Zulax," you must trademark it in Class 25 (the clothes) and Class 35 (the retail store that sells them).
  • The Cost: You must pay a and fee for EACH class. There is no "Bulk" discount for multiple classes.

🏢 4. Why Choosing the Right Class Matters

  • The Trap: You register "Zulax" in Class 1 (Chemicals) because it was cheap and available. But you are selling luxury perfumes (Class 3).
  • The Result: A competitor can register "Zulax" in Class 3 and ban you from selling your own perfume. Your Class 1 trademark gives you ZERO protection in the perfume market.

📝 5. How to Identify Your Class

  1. Define the Product: What is the thing your customer pays for?
  2. Audit the Manual: Check the Nice Classification Manual for the specific keyword.
  3. Confirm with an Agent: Use an accredited agent to verify the choice. They have "Zero-Mistake Insurance" experience with "Borderline" products.

Before you file, you search by class.

  • The Logic: "Star" might be taken in Class 32 (Beer) but available in Class 9 (Software). You can only own it in the classes where it is free.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Can I change my class after filing?

No. Once you file, the class is locked. If you made a mistake, you must file a new application and pay again.

2. Is class 45 for everything else?

No. Class 45 is for specific legal, social, and security services. Every product has an home somewhere in the 45 classes.

3. Does one class cover the whole world?

The class system is international, but your registration is only valid in Nigeria. You must register in other countries separately.
